The title of Knight Bachelor is the basic rank granted to a man who has been knighted by the monarch but not inducted as a member of one of the organised orders of chivalry; it is a part of the British honours system. The knight grand cross was the highest rank of knighthood. It was a title that was granted to knights who had distinguished themselves in service to the king or queen . Knight grand crosses were given the right to wear a special sash, which was worn across the body from the right shoulder to the left hip.

Queen Elizabeth knighted Elton John in 1998. Mike Flokis/Getty Images. As we mentioned earlier, the military aspects of knighthood faded with the increased use of firearms and gunpowder. Armor couldn't protect knights from gunshots, and firearms didn't require the skills and training that armed combat with swords and lances did.

Baltic Noble Corporations of Courland, Livonia, Estonia, and Oesel (Ösel) were medieval fiefdoms formed by German nobles in the 13th century under vassalage to the Teutonic Knights and Denmark in modern Latvia and Estonia. Knight bachelor, most ancient, albeit lower ranking, form of English knighthood, with its origin dating to the reign of Henry III in the 13th century. The feudalization of England that followed the Norman Conquest of 1066 integrated the knights, then around 5,000 in number, into the new system. While knights are usually thought of in connection with medieval life, the tradition of conferring knighthood has not died, at least in England. In 1997 rock star Paul McCartney , one of the original Beatles of the 1960s, was knighted by England's Queen Elizabeth II during a ceremony in London.
